What is happening?!

Sparks are flying from their eyes. They’ve been glaring at each other for awhile now. The fiery gold-red head in the black leather jacket snickers at the sky-blue headed girl in a greyish-blue jumper baring her teeth in return. And somehow I got caught in the middle!

I was trapped. I can’t even slip away with their hands pressed against the school lockers blocking off my left and right. All I could do is quiver and shrink back against the lockers merging myself into them.

“Are you a friend of hers?” says the girl in the black jacket.

“That is of no concern to you, Sunset Shimmer,” says the girl in the blue jumper.

“Then is there something between you two?”

“Like there's anything between her and Trixie.”

“Then surely you don't mind me having a little chat with Twilight here,” Sunset to my right declares, pulling me to her side.

“Says the one being awfully close to her when you just met,” Trixie to my left retorts, pulling me off towards her.

My arms ache and my head throbs from the momentum as the two girls engage in their tug of war with me as the rope. My body becomes heavy like dead weight covering all over me. But I was too distracted to notice the pain as my mind ponders this incomprehensible situation. Even worse when this scene had attracted a large crowd how curiosity bit them in the bud. I can feel their eyes leering all over us and I can't help be red in the face along with a burning sensation in my cheeks.

Why is this happening to me?!
